Hopeful
What does being hopeful mean?
Holding on and working for a better future.
If I am being Hopeful I can:
• Understand being hopeful is about combining goals with action and energy.
• Learn that when we are hopeful it results in us feeling more joyful and peaceful.
• Not give up, even when things are difficult.
• Work hard to overcome challenges.
• Think through different possibilities and options in order to achieves my goals.
• Look for solutions and asks for help if needed.
• Encourage others to see that they can succeed and help them to become their best selves too.
• Speak to others in a manner that motivates and brings hope.
• Celebrate the achievements, big and small, of myself and others.
Activities:
• Write down a goal/goals and think about what you can do to achieve them,
• Think about a time you overcame something by not giving up. Is there something you are putting off that you could do by being more hopeful?
• Encourage someone else to be the best version of themselves – be positive!
• Write down 3 things you are proud of achieving and 2 things you want to do better. How will you do this?
• If you have a negative thought, how can you reframe it in a positive way?
• Plant a seed – nurture it and be hopeful
• Draw a picture of what you hope the future to be like
